Discounted Cash Flow (DCF) Valuation Explained: A Complete Guide for Business Owners & Investors

Determining the value of a business requires more than reviewing historical financial statements or applying industry valuation multiples. Investors, lenders, business owners, and financial advisors are ultimately interested in one fundamental question:

How much are the future cash flows of this business worth today?

The Discounted Cash Flow (DCF) method answers that question.

Widely regarded as one of the most robust and widely accepted valuation methodologies, DCF estimates the intrinsic value of a business by projecting the future cash flows it is expected to generate and converting those future benefits into present value.

Unlike market-based valuation methods, which rely on comparable companies or recent transactions, DCF focuses on the unique economics of the business itself. It evaluates future operating performance, expected growth, capital investment requirements, and business-specific risks to estimate what the company is worth based on its ability to generate cash over time.

Because of this forward-looking approach, DCF is commonly used in mergers and acquisitions, private equity investments, financial reporting, strategic planning, fairness opinions, fundraising, and corporate finance.

When supported by realistic assumptions and rigorous financial analysis, the DCF method provides decision-makers with a powerful framework for assessing business value.

In this guide, we’ll explain how Discounted Cash Flow valuation works, why it is widely used by valuation professionals, the key assumptions that drive the analysis, and the situations where DCF provides the most meaningful indication of value.

What Is Discounted Cash Flow (DCF)?

Discounted Cash Flow (DCF) is a valuation method that estimates the value of a business based on the present value of its expected future free cash flows.

Rather than focusing on what a company earned in the past, DCF evaluates the economic benefits the business is expected to generate in the future.

The concept is grounded in one of the most fundamental principles of finance:

A dollar received today is worth more than a dollar received in the future.

This principle, known as the time value of money, recognizes that money available today can be invested, earn a return, and carry less uncertainty than money expected years from now.

Accordingly, future cash flows must be discounted back to their present value using a discount rate that reflects both the time value of money and the risks associated with achieving those cash flows.

The combined present value of these projected cash flows represents the estimated enterprise value of the business.

Why Investors Prefer DCF

Professional investors are generally less interested in historical accounting profits than they are in a company’s ability to generate future cash.

For example:

Two businesses may each report $5 million in annual net income.

However:

  • Company A is expected to grow at 20% annually for the next decade.
  • Company B is expected to remain flat with minimal growth.

Although their current earnings are identical, Company A is likely worth significantly more because it is expected to generate greater future economic benefits.

The DCF method captures these differences by incorporating future growth expectations into the valuation.

The Core Principle Behind DCF

At its core, DCF attempts to answer a simple investment question:

If I purchase this business today, what are its future cash flows worth after accounting for time and risk?

To answer this, valuation professionals estimate:

  • Future operating performance
  • Free cash flow generation
  • Required capital investments
  • Business risk
  • Long-term growth potential

Each projected cash flow is then discounted back to today’s value.

The sum of these discounted cash flows represents the estimated value of the operating business.

Why Future Cash Flow Matters More Than Accounting Profit

Many business owners focus primarily on revenue or net income.

However, investors generally place greater emphasis on Free Cash Flow (FCF) because it represents the cash available to investors after the business has funded its operations and necessary investments.

A company may report strong accounting profits while generating limited cash because of:

  • Significant capital expenditures
  • Rising inventory
  • Increasing accounts receivable
  • High debt servicing requirements

Conversely, a business with moderate accounting earnings may produce substantial free cash flow due to efficient operations and limited reinvestment needs.

This is why DCF relies primarily on cash flow rather than accounting profit.

Why DCF Is Considered One of the Most Reliable Valuation Methods

Among professional valuation methodologies, DCF is often viewed as one of the most comprehensive because it:

  • Focuses on company-specific performance
  • Incorporates future growth expectations
  • Reflects business-specific risk
  • Supports strategic decision-making
  • Does not rely solely on comparable companies
  • Adapts to changing business conditions

Rather than assuming the market has already priced similar businesses correctly, DCF develops an independent estimate of intrinsic value.

This makes it particularly useful for businesses with unique characteristics or limited comparable market data.

When Is DCF Most Appropriate?

The Discounted Cash Flow method is commonly used when:

  • Reliable financial forecasts are available
  • Future cash flows can be estimated with reasonable confidence
  • Management has a well-developed strategic plan
  • The business is expected to continue as a going concern
  • Growth prospects are an important driver of value

Examples include:

  • Technology companies
  • Software-as-a-Service (SaaS) businesses
  • Healthcare organizations
  • Manufacturing companies
  • Professional service firms
  • Consumer product businesses
  • Infrastructure and energy companies

Situations Where DCF May Be Less Appropriate

Although DCF is highly respected, it is not suitable for every valuation engagement.

It may be less reliable when:

  • Financial projections are highly uncertain
  • Businesses are in severe financial distress
  • Cash flows are extremely volatile
  • Historical performance is inconsistent
  • The company lacks sufficient operating history
  • Reliable forecasting is not possible

In such situations, valuation professionals may place greater reliance on the Market Approach or Asset Approach.

Key Components of a DCF Valuation

Every DCF model is built around several core components:

  • Historical financial analysis
  • Revenue forecasting
  • Operating margin projections
  • Free Cash Flow estimation
  • Capital expenditure planning
  • Working capital analysis
  • Discount rate selection
  • Terminal value calculation
  • Present value analysis

Each component influences the final valuation and must be supported by reasonable assumptions and reliable financial data.

How to Build a Discounted Cash Flow (DCF) Model

A Discounted Cash Flow valuation is only as reliable as the assumptions and financial analysis behind it. While the mathematical calculations are important, experienced valuation professionals spend significant time understanding the business before building the model.

A professionally prepared DCF model typically follows a structured process that transforms historical financial information into a forward-looking estimate of enterprise value.

Although every valuation engagement is unique, most DCF models include the following steps.

Step 1: Analyze Historical Financial Performance

The first step is understanding how the business has performed historically.

Past performance does not determine future value, but it provides the foundation for forecasting future cash flows.

Professionals typically review at least three to five years of historical financial information, including:

Income Statement

Key areas include:

  • Revenue
  • Cost of Goods Sold (COGS)
  • Gross Profit
  • Operating Expenses
  • EBITDA
  • EBIT
  • Net Income

The objective is to identify profitability trends and understand the company’s operating performance.

Balance Sheet

The balance sheet helps professionals evaluate:

  • Working capital
  • Cash balances
  • Debt levels
  • Fixed assets
  • Inventory management
  • Accounts receivable
  • Accounts payable

Understanding these balances is essential because they directly affect future cash flow.

Cash Flow Statement

Cash flow analysis provides insight into:

  • Operating cash generation
  • Capital expenditures
  • Financing activities
  • Investment requirements

Since DCF focuses on cash rather than accounting profit, this analysis is particularly important.

Step 2: Forecast Revenue

Revenue projections form the foundation of every DCF model.

Rather than relying on arbitrary growth assumptions, valuation professionals evaluate multiple factors, including:

  • Historical growth trends
  • Industry outlook
  • Market size
  • Customer demand
  • Competitive positioning
  • Pricing strategy
  • Economic conditions
  • Management forecasts
  • New product launches
  • Geographic expansion

For example:

YearRevenue
2025$15.0 Million
2026$16.8 Million
2027$18.6 Million
2028$20.3 Million
2029$22.1 Million

The growth assumptions should be realistic, internally consistent, and supported by available evidence.

Professionals often test multiple scenarios—such as conservative, base-case, and optimistic forecasts—to understand how changes in revenue growth affect valuation.

Step 3: Project Operating Expenses

Once revenue has been projected, the next step is estimating future operating costs.

These generally include:

  • Cost of Goods Sold
  • Payroll
  • Sales & Marketing
  • Research & Development
  • General & Administrative Expenses
  • Rent
  • Insurance
  • Technology Costs

The objective is to forecast sustainable operating margins rather than simply extending historical percentages.

Professionals also consider expected cost efficiencies, inflation, hiring plans, and operational improvements.

Step 4: Estimate EBITDA

EBITDA (Earnings Before Interest, Taxes, Depreciation, and Amortization) is one of the most important performance measures in business valuation.

It provides an indication of operating profitability before financing and certain accounting decisions.

For example:

YearRevenueEBITDA MarginEBITDA
2025$15.0M24%$3.6M
2026$16.8M25%$4.2M
2027$18.6M26%$4.8M
2028$20.3M27%$5.5M
2029$22.1M27%$6.0M

Improving EBITDA margins often indicate stronger operational efficiency and can significantly influence business value.

Step 5: Calculate EBIT

EBIT (Earnings Before Interest and Taxes) adjusts EBITDA by deducting depreciation and amortization.

While depreciation is a non-cash accounting expense, it reflects the consumption of long-term assets over time.

Professionals analyze depreciation trends to ensure projected capital expenditures remain consistent with future operating requirements.

Step 6: Estimate Taxes

DCF models typically use operating taxes rather than actual taxes paid by a specific owner.

This approach reflects the tax burden that a hypothetical market participant would reasonably expect.

Professionals consider:

  • Corporate tax rates
  • Deferred taxes
  • Tax legislation
  • Jurisdiction-specific requirements

Using normalized tax assumptions improves comparability across different businesses.

Step 7: Forecast Capital Expenditures (CapEx)

Every operating business must invest in assets to maintain or expand operations.

Capital expenditures may include:

  • Manufacturing equipment
  • Technology infrastructure
  • Office facilities
  • Vehicles
  • Software platforms
  • Production machinery

CapEx is deducted when calculating Free Cash Flow because these investments require cash.

Growth-oriented businesses often require higher capital investment than mature businesses.

Step 8: Estimate Depreciation & Amortization

Although depreciation and amortization reduce accounting profit, they do not represent current-period cash outflows.

Accordingly:

  • They reduce taxable income.
  • They are added back when calculating Free Cash Flow.

Professionals forecast these expenses based on existing asset schedules and anticipated future investments.

Step 9: Analyze Working Capital

Working capital has a direct impact on cash flow.

Even profitable businesses can experience cash shortages if working capital requirements increase significantly.

Professionals analyze:

  • Accounts Receivable
  • Inventory
  • Accounts Payable
  • Prepaid Expenses
  • Accrued Liabilities

For example:

If revenue grows rapidly, additional inventory and receivables may consume cash, reducing Free Cash Flow.

Step 10: Calculate Free Cash Flow (FCF)

After forecasting revenue, expenses, taxes, capital expenditures, and working capital, professionals estimate Free Cash Flow.

Free Cash Flow represents the cash available to investors after funding the business’s ongoing operating and investment needs.

Typical adjustments include:

  • Start with operating profit after taxes
  • Add back depreciation and amortization
  • Deduct capital expenditures
  • Adjust for changes in working capital

This projected Free Cash Flow becomes the foundation of the DCF valuation.

Why Forecast Quality Matters

Even the most sophisticated DCF model can produce misleading results if the underlying assumptions are unrealistic.

Experienced valuation professionals evaluate whether forecasts are supported by:

  • Historical performance
  • Industry benchmarks
  • Market conditions
  • Customer demand
  • Operational capacity
  • Management strategy
  • Economic outlook

The objective is to produce projections that are ambitious yet achievable.

Common Forecasting Mistakes

Some of the most common errors in DCF modeling include:

  • Assuming unrealistic revenue growth
  • Ignoring future capital investment needs
  • Underestimating working capital requirements
  • Using inconsistent operating margins
  • Failing to normalize financial statements
  • Ignoring economic cycles
  • Overlooking competitive risks

Avoiding these mistakes improves the reliability and credibility of the valuation.

Understanding the Discount Rate in a DCF Valuation

Once future Free Cash Flows have been projected, the next step is determining how much those future cash flows are worth today.

This is where the discount rate becomes one of the most important assumptions in the entire valuation process.

The discount rate reflects two key concepts:

  • The time value of money, recognizing that money received today is worth more than the same amount received in the future.
  • Investment risk, acknowledging that future cash flows are uncertain and investors require compensation for taking that risk.

In a DCF valuation, each projected cash flow is discounted back to its present value using an appropriate discount rate. Higher risk generally results in a higher discount rate, which reduces the present value of future cash flows. Lower risk results in a lower discount rate and a higher present value.

Why the Discount Rate Matters

Consider two businesses expected to generate identical future cash flows.

  • Company A operates in a mature industry with stable earnings, diversified customers, and predictable growth.
  • Company B is an early-stage technology company with volatile earnings and uncertain market demand.

Although both companies may generate similar projected cash flows, investors will typically assign a higher discount rate to Company B because of its greater uncertainty.

As a result, Company B’s projected cash flows are worth less in today’s dollars, leading to a lower valuation unless its growth potential justifies the additional risk.

This illustrates why the discount rate is just as important as the cash flow projections themselves.

What Is Weighted Average Cost of Capital (WACC)?

For most operating businesses, the discount rate used in a DCF valuation is the Weighted Average Cost of Capital (WACC).

WACC represents the average rate of return that investors expect for providing capital to the business.

Because companies are generally financed through a combination of equity and debt, WACC incorporates the cost of both financing sources, weighted according to their proportion in the company’s capital structure.

A properly estimated WACC reflects the overall opportunity cost of investing in the business.

Components of WACC

A professional valuation specialist generally calculates WACC using four primary inputs:

1. Cost of Equity

The Cost of Equity represents the return required by shareholders for investing in the company.

Unlike lenders, shareholders are not guaranteed repayment. They assume greater risk and therefore expect higher returns.

The Cost of Equity is commonly estimated using the Capital Asset Pricing Model (CAPM).

Where:

  • Rf = Risk-Free Rate
  • β (Beta) = Measure of business risk relative to the market
  • Rm − Rf = Equity Risk Premium

This model estimates the return equity investors require based on the company’s systematic risk.

2. Risk-Free Rate

The Risk-Free Rate represents the return available on an investment with minimal default risk.

In many U.S. valuation engagements, professionals commonly reference yields on long-term U.S. Treasury securities as a starting point.

The Risk-Free Rate establishes the baseline return that investors can earn without taking meaningful business risk.

3. Beta

Beta measures how sensitive a company’s returns are relative to the overall market.

  • Beta = 1.0 indicates the company generally moves in line with the market.
  • Beta greater than 1.0 suggests higher volatility and risk.
  • Beta less than 1.0 indicates lower relative risk.

For privately held businesses, valuation professionals often estimate Beta using publicly traded comparable companies and then adjust it to reflect the subject company’s capital structure and operating characteristics.

4. Equity Risk Premium (ERP)

Investors expect higher returns when investing in equities rather than risk-free assets.

The Equity Risk Premium represents this additional expected return.

Factors influencing ERP include:

  • Overall market conditions
  • Economic outlook
  • Investor sentiment
  • Long-term market performance

Together with the Risk-Free Rate and Beta, ERP helps estimate the return required by equity investors.

Cost of Debt

Most businesses finance operations using a combination of equity and borrowed funds.

The Cost of Debt reflects the effective interest rate a company pays on its borrowings after considering tax benefits.

Because interest expense is generally tax-deductible, the after-tax cost of debt is often lower than the stated borrowing rate.

Factors influencing the Cost of Debt include:

  • Credit quality
  • Interest rate environment
  • Debt maturity
  • Collateral
  • Industry risk
  • Company-specific financial strength

A stronger credit profile generally results in a lower borrowing cost.

Determining the Appropriate Capital Structure

The weights assigned to debt and equity within WACC are equally important.

Rather than relying solely on the company’s current financing mix, professionals often evaluate:

  • Industry norms
  • Comparable companies
  • Long-term target capital structure
  • Market participant assumptions

This approach produces a discount rate that better reflects how a typical investor would finance a comparable business.

Terminal Value

Most DCF models explicitly forecast cash flows for five to ten years.

However, businesses are generally expected to continue operating beyond the explicit forecast period.

To capture this remaining economic value, valuation professionals calculate a Terminal Value, which often represents a substantial portion of the total enterprise value.

There are two widely accepted methods for estimating Terminal Value.

Perpetual Growth Method

The Perpetual Growth Method assumes that after the explicit forecast period, the business will continue generating cash flows that grow at a stable long-term rate indefinitely.

Where:

  • TV = Terminal Value
  • FCFₙ₊₁ = Free Cash Flow in the first year after the forecast period
  • WACC = Discount Rate
  • g = Long-term sustainable growth rate

The perpetual growth rate is typically conservative and should reflect the long-term economic growth expected for mature businesses.

Exit Multiple Method

The Exit Multiple Method estimates Terminal Value by applying an appropriate market multiple—such as Enterprise Value / EBITDA—to the company’s projected financial performance in the final forecast year.

This method aligns the DCF analysis with observable market valuation data and is commonly used in mergers and acquisitions, investment banking, and private equity transactions.

Selecting a realistic exit multiple requires careful analysis of comparable companies and recent transactions.

Present Value of Cash Flows

Once the discount rate and Terminal Value have been determined, each projected Free Cash Flow is discounted back to its present value.

The present values of:

  • Annual Free Cash Flows, and
  • Terminal Value

are then combined to estimate the company’s Enterprise Value.

This is the core objective of the DCF valuation process.

Sensitivity Analysis

No valuation is based on a single perfect assumption.

Professionals therefore perform Sensitivity Analysis to understand how changes in key assumptions affect valuation.

Typical variables tested include:

  • Revenue growth rates
  • EBITDA margins
  • Discount rate (WACC)
  • Terminal growth rate
  • Exit multiples
  • Capital expenditures

For example, increasing WACC by just 1% may reduce the estimated enterprise value by a significant margin, while lowering the terminal growth rate can produce a similarly meaningful impact.

Sensitivity analysis helps decision-makers understand the range of potential values rather than relying on a single point estimate.

Common Mistakes When Estimating WACC

Even experienced analysts can introduce errors if assumptions are not carefully evaluated.

Common mistakes include:

  • Using an outdated Risk-Free Rate
  • Selecting inappropriate comparable companies for Beta
  • Applying unrealistic capital structures
  • Ignoring company-specific risks
  • Assuming excessive terminal growth rates
  • Using inconsistent market assumptions
  • Failing to reconcile WACC with industry benchmarks

A well-supported discount rate should be internally consistent, market-based, and appropriate for the characteristics of the business being valued.

A Practical Discounted Cash Flow (DCF) Valuation Example

Understanding the theory behind Discounted Cash Flow (DCF) is important, but seeing how the methodology is applied in practice makes the process much easier to understand.

The following example illustrates a simplified DCF valuation for a hypothetical private company. While real-world valuation models are significantly more detailed and often include hundreds of assumptions, this example demonstrates the overall workflow used by valuation professionals.

Company Overview

Assume we are valuing ABC Manufacturing Inc., a privately owned industrial equipment manufacturer.

Company Profile
  • Industry: Manufacturing
  • Annual Revenue: $25 Million
  • EBITDA Margin: 22%
  • Revenue Growth: Moderate
  • Debt: Low
  • Stable customer base
  • Positive operating history

Management expects the company to continue growing steadily over the next five years.

Step 1: Forecast Revenue

Based on historical performance, market demand, and management expectations, the valuation team projects the following revenue:

YearProjected Revenue
Year 1$26.5 Million
Year 2$28.1 Million
Year 3$29.8 Million
Year 4$31.4 Million
Year 5$33.0 Million

The assumptions reflect stable organic growth rather than aggressive expansion.

Step 2: Estimate Free Cash Flow

After projecting operating expenses, taxes, capital expenditures, depreciation, and working capital requirements, the valuation specialist estimates the company’s annual Free Cash Flow.

YearFree Cash Flow
Year 1$2.8 Million
Year 2$3.1 Million
Year 3$3.4 Million
Year 4$3.7 Million
Year 5$4.0 Million

These cash flows represent the amount available to all providers of capital after funding the company’s operating and investment needs.

Step 3: Determine the Discount Rate

After evaluating:

  • Industry risk
  • Comparable public companies
  • Capital structure
  • Cost of debt
  • Cost of equity

the valuation team estimates the company’s Weighted Average Cost of Capital (WACC) at:

9.5%

This rate reflects the expected return required by market participants for investing in a business with similar characteristics.

Step 4: Discount the Future Cash Flows

Each year’s projected Free Cash Flow is discounted back to its present value using the selected WACC.

YearFree Cash FlowPresent Value
Year 1$2.8M$2.56M
Year 2$3.1M$2.59M
Year 3$3.4M$2.60M
Year 4$3.7M$2.59M
Year 5$4.0M$2.57M

Notice that although future cash flows increase each year, their present values remain relatively stable because they are discounted to reflect the time value of money and investment risk.

Step 5: Estimate Terminal Value

Since the business is expected to continue operating beyond Year 5, the valuation team estimates a Terminal Value using the Perpetual Growth Method.

Assumptions:

  • Final Year Free Cash Flow: $4.0 Million
  • Long-Term Growth Rate: 2.5%
  • WACC: 9.5%

Using these assumptions, the estimated Terminal Value is approximately:

$58.8 Million

The Terminal Value represents the value of all future cash flows beyond the explicit forecast period.

Step 6: Discount the Terminal Value

Because the Terminal Value is calculated as of the end of Year 5, it must also be discounted to present value.

Present Value of Terminal Value:

Approximately $37.5 Million

Step 7: Calculate Enterprise Value

The Enterprise Value is calculated by adding:

  • Present Value of Forecast Cash Flows
  • Present Value of Terminal Value
ComponentValue
Present Value of Annual Cash Flows$12.9 Million
Present Value of Terminal Value$37.5 Million
Enterprise Value$50.4 Million

This represents the estimated value of the company’s operating business.

Step 8: Calculate Equity Value

Enterprise Value includes both debt and equity.

To estimate the value attributable to shareholders, adjustments are made for:

  • Interest-bearing debt
  • Excess cash
  • Non-operating assets

Example:

ItemValue
Enterprise Value$50.4 Million
Less: Outstanding Debt($6.0 Million)
Add: Excess Cash$2.4 Million
Estimated Equity Value$46.8 Million

This is the estimated value available to equity holders.

Interpreting the Results

The DCF valuation suggests that ABC Manufacturing’s value is driven not only by its current financial performance but also by its expected ability to generate future cash flows.

Even though today’s financial statements provide useful information, the valuation ultimately reflects investors’ expectations about the company’s future profitability, growth, and risk.

This forward-looking perspective is one of the primary reasons DCF is widely used in corporate finance and investment analysis.

Advantages of the DCF Method

When supported by realistic assumptions, DCF offers several important benefits.

Focuses on Intrinsic Value

DCF estimates value based on the company’s own expected performance rather than relying solely on market comparisons.

Forward-Looking

It incorporates projected growth, future profitability, and strategic initiatives.

Flexible

The methodology can be adapted to businesses of different sizes, industries, and life-cycle stages.

Comprehensive

DCF considers multiple financial drivers, including:

  • Revenue growth
  • Operating margins
  • Capital expenditures
  • Working capital
  • Financing costs
  • Long-term growth expectations

Widely Accepted

DCF is commonly used in:

  • Mergers & Acquisitions
  • Private Equity
  • Investment Banking
  • Financial Reporting
  • Strategic Planning
  • Fairness Opinions
  • Business Valuation Engagements

Limitations of the DCF Method

Despite its strengths, DCF is highly sensitive to assumptions.

Forecast Risk

Small changes in projected revenue or margins can materially affect valuation.

Discount Rate Sensitivity

Even a modest increase or decrease in WACC can significantly change Enterprise Value.

Terminal Value Dependence

For many companies, the Terminal Value represents 60–80% of the total valuation.

As a result, unrealistic long-term growth assumptions can distort the analysis.

Forecasting Uncertainty

Industries with volatile earnings or rapidly changing market conditions are generally more difficult to forecast accurately.

Common Mistakes in DCF Valuation

Business owners and inexperienced analysts frequently make errors such as:

  • Using unrealistic revenue growth assumptions
  • Ignoring future capital investment needs
  • Underestimating working capital requirements
  • Selecting an inappropriate discount rate
  • Applying excessive terminal growth rates
  • Double-counting cash flows
  • Failing to normalize financial statements
  • Assuming today’s market conditions will remain unchanged indefinitely

Professional valuation requires careful judgment, industry knowledge, and well-supported financial assumptions.

When Should You Use the Discounted Cash Flow (DCF) Method?

Although DCF is one of the most respected business valuation methodologies, it is not the best choice for every situation. The quality of a DCF valuation depends heavily on the reliability of the underlying financial projections and assumptions.

Valuation professionals generally recommend the DCF method when a business has predictable operating performance, sufficient historical financial information, and management can reasonably forecast future cash flows.

DCF is particularly appropriate in the following situations:

Established Operating Businesses

Companies with stable revenue, consistent profitability, and a proven operating history are often well suited for DCF analysis because future cash flows can be projected with greater confidence.

Mergers and Acquisitions

Strategic buyers and private equity investors frequently use DCF to estimate the intrinsic value of acquisition targets and compare that value with market pricing.

Financial Reporting

DCF is commonly used in valuations prepared for:

  • Purchase Price Allocation (ASC 805)
  • Goodwill Impairment Testing (ASC 350)
  • Fair Value Measurement (ASC 820)

Because these engagements require fair value estimates, discounted cash flow analysis is often an important component of the valuation.

Fundraising

Investors evaluating growth companies often rely on DCF to understand whether projected future returns justify the proposed investment.

Strategic Planning

Business owners use DCF to evaluate:

  • Expansion opportunities
  • Capital investment decisions
  • Acquisitions
  • Divestitures
  • Long-term value creation initiatives

Because DCF links business strategy directly to value, it is an effective planning tool.

When Should DCF Be Used with Caution?

While DCF is a powerful methodology, there are situations where its results may be less reliable.

Early-Stage Startups

Companies with limited operating history and highly uncertain revenue projections may not have sufficiently reliable cash flow forecasts.

Distressed Businesses

Organizations experiencing financial distress often have unpredictable cash flows, making long-term projections difficult.

Highly Cyclical Industries

Businesses whose performance fluctuates significantly due to economic cycles may require additional scenario analysis and sensitivity testing.

Limited Financial Information

If reliable historical financial data is unavailable, the assumptions required for DCF become increasingly speculative.

In these situations, valuation professionals often supplement DCF with the Market Approach or Asset Approach to develop a more balanced conclusion.

DCF vs. Other Business Valuation Methods

Each valuation methodology answers a different question and serves a different purpose.

Valuation MethodBest Used WhenPrimary Focus
Discounted Cash Flow (DCF)Reliable future projections are availableFuture earning potential
Market ApproachComparable companies or transactions existMarket evidence
Asset ApproachBusiness value is driven by assetsNet asset value

Rather than viewing these methods as competing alternatives, experienced valuation professionals evaluate which methodology—or combination of methodologies—best reflects the economic characteristics of the business.

Common Misconceptions About DCF Valuation

Misconception #1: DCF Is Just a Spreadsheet Calculation

While spreadsheet software performs the calculations, the quality of a DCF valuation depends on the assumptions behind the model.

Forecast quality, industry knowledge, and professional judgment are far more important than the formulas themselves.

Misconception #2: Higher Revenue Automatically Means Higher Value

Revenue growth alone does not determine business value.

Investors also evaluate:

  • Operating margins
  • Free Cash Flow
  • Capital requirements
  • Working capital needs
  • Business risk
  • Long-term sustainability

A company growing rapidly but consuming significant cash may be worth less than a slower-growing business with strong and consistent Free Cash Flow.

Misconception #3: DCF Produces One Exact Value

DCF does not produce a guaranteed or absolute value.

Instead, it provides an estimate based on reasonable assumptions.

Professional valuation reports often include sensitivity analyses to demonstrate how changes in key assumptions affect valuation outcomes.

Misconception #4: The Highest Valuation Is the Correct One

The objective of valuation is not to maximize value but to estimate fair value objectively.

Independent valuation professionals apply consistent methodologies, market evidence, and professional judgment to arrive at a supportable conclusion.

Misconception #5: DCF Can Replace Professional Judgment

Even the most sophisticated financial model cannot replace experience.

Professional valuation specialists evaluate qualitative factors such as:

  • Competitive positioning
  • Industry outlook
  • Customer concentration
  • Management capability
  • Regulatory risks
  • Market conditions

These considerations influence both the assumptions used and the interpretation of valuation results.
